Video: Dab tsi yog kev siv algorithm hauv computer programming?
2024 Tus sau: Lynn Donovan | [email protected]. Kawg hloov kho: 2023-12-15 23:47
A programming algorithm yog a lub computer txheej txheem uas zoo li ib daim ntawv qhia (hu ua tus txheej txheem) thiab qhia koj lub computer precisely yuav ua li cas cov kauj ruam los daws qhov teeb meem los yog mus txog lub hom phiaj. Cov khoom xyaw yog hu ua inputs, hos cov ntsiab lus hu ua outputs.
Kuj nug, dab tsi yog qhov algorithm hauv kev suav?
Ib algorithm yog ib tug txheej txheem zoo uas tso cai rau a lub computer daws teeb meem. Lwm txoj kev los piav txog ib qho algorithm yog ib theem zuj zus ntawm unambiguousinstructions. Qhov tseeb, nws nyuaj rau xav txog ib txoj haujlwm uas koj ua lub computer uas tsis siv algorithms.
Ib tug kuj yuav nug, dab tsi yog algorithm thiab nws ua haujlwm li cas? Ib algorithm , rau cov uas tsis yog-programmers ntawm peb, yog ib txheej ntawm cov lus qhia uas coj ib tug input, A, thiab muab anoutput, B, uas hloov cov ntaub ntawv koom nyob rau hauv tej txoj kev. Algorithms muaj ntau yam kev siv. Hauv kev ua lej, lawv tuaj yeem pab xam cov haujlwm los ntawm cov ntsiab lus hauv cov ntaub ntawv teev tseg, nrog rau ntau yam ntxiv.
Ib yam li ntawd, koj tuaj yeem nug, qhov piv txwv ntawm ib qho algorithm yog dab tsi?
Ib algorithms yog ib kauj ruam los ntawm cov txheej txheem los daws cov teeb meem logical thiab lej. Daim ntawv qhia yog ib qho zoo piv txwv ntawm ib qho algorithm vim nws qhia koj tias koj yuav tsum ua ib kauj ruam zuj zus. Nws siv cov khoom siv (cov khoom xyaw) thiab tsim cov khoom lag luam (cov tais ua tiav).
Vim li cas algorithms tseem ceeb hauv computer science?
Algorithms yog ib heev tseem ceeb lub ntsiab lus hauv Computer Science vim tias lawv pab cov tsim software tsim kom muaj txiaj ntsig zoo thiab ua yuam kev dawb cov kev pab cuam. Feem ntau tseem ceeb yam yuav tsum nco ntsoov txog algorithms yog tias muaj ntau yam sib txawv algorithms rau tib qho teeb meem, tab sis qee qhov zoo dua li lwm tus!
Pom zoo:
Dab tsi ntawm cov hauv qab no yog qhov zoo ntawm kev siv cov khoom siv pom kev hauv kev hais lus?
Qhov txiaj ntsig tseem ceeb ntawm kev siv cov khoom siv pom hauv koj cov lus hais yog tias lawv ua kom cov neeg tuaj saib muaj kev txaus siab, hloov kev mloog ntawm tus neeg hais lus, thiab ua rau tus neeg hais lus muaj kev ntseeg siab ntau dua hauv kev nthuav qhia tag nrho
Dab tsi yog txoj hauv kev zoo ntawm cov neeg siv kev lees paub thaum nkag mus rau lub computer?
Cov no suav nrog ob qho tib si kev lees paub dav dav (passwords, two-factor authentication [2FA], tokens, biometrics, transaction authentication, computer recognition, CAPTCHAs, and single sign-on [SSO]) as well as authentication protocols (xws li Kerberos thiab SSL/ TLS)
Dab tsi yog kev siv computer hauv kev tshaj tawm?
Tsim Kev Tshaj Tawm rau Lwm Cov Xov Xwm Thaum Is Taws Nem tso cai rau cov tuam txhab siv khoos phis tawj rau kev tshaj tawm, tshawb fawb thiab kev faib tawm, cov khoos phis tawj kuj tau siv los pab npaj kev tshaj tawm rau lwm cov xov xwm. Piv txwv li, niaj hnub luam ntawv cov ntawv xov xwm thiab ntawv xov xwm feem ntau siv computers los pab tsim cov layouts ntawm nplooj ntawv
Dab tsi yog qhov sib txawv ntawm cov txheej txheem programming thiab modular programming?
Structured programming yog qib qis ntawm coding hauv txoj kev ntse, thiab kev ua haujlwm modular yog qib siab dua. Modular programming yog hais txog kev sib cais qhov chaw ntawm cov kev pab cuam rau hauv kev ywj pheej thiab hloov pauv tau, los txhim kho kev sim, kev tswj xyuas, kev sib cais ntawm kev txhawj xeeb thiab rov siv dua
Dab tsi yog kev siv cov ntawv cim kev cai li cas koj nkag mus rau hauv Apex cov chav kawm thiab hauv Visualforce nplooj ntawv?
Cov ntawv sau kev cai tso cai rau cov neeg tsim khoom tsim cov ntawv thov ntau hom lus los ntawm kev nthuav qhia cov ntaub ntawv (piv txwv li, pab cov ntawv lossis cov lus yuam kev) hauv tus neeg siv hom lus. Cov ntawv sau kev cai yog cov ntawv sau muaj txiaj ntsig uas tuaj yeem nkag tau los ntawm Apex cov chav kawm, nplooj ntawv Visualforce, lossis cov khoom siv xob laim